    Back down here in SoCal on business. At least I found another trailer and this one is a M416. Sorry no photos, I went an looked at it in the dark. I put a deposit on this one so it wouldn't be sold out from under me too. Anyway, I think I'm going to buy it because it is very straight and there is very little rust. It has a few modifications done to it during rebuild by some P.O. 2" ball coupler mount and a very well done tail gate seem to be the big changes. Searching the net this morning I found info about the B1. This trailer has the frame mounted lifting hoops like a rare B1. Most of the other B1 items are missing, no surge brakes and no gas can mounts and the wheels are standard M416. Owner only knows it as a military trailer so no help there. Going out to see it again this moring in the day light and record the numbers and get a few photos. Check back and help me I.D. this thing. I will include photos and the price.

    With the lifting hoops but without the surge brake and can mounts it sounds like a Marine Corp. M416 to me rather than a M416B1.

    Mine look's very similiar to that one, even same color, (not as nice a shape though) minus the lift ring's and tailgate of course. That tailgate appear's to have been done nicely and not hacked up. I want to convert mine to a tailgate to make it more user (and back) friendly!

    Mine came with the surge brake's and non swiveling pintle ring but I removed them both and welded in dual 2" reciever hitches for varying hitch height's. The surge brake's were inop and the pintle ring assembly had been bent. Mine also came with what appeared to be a fire extinguisher holder, which I also removed.

    I would also agree that your's was more than likely Navy/Marine Corps issue with the lift ring's. Good luck with your new trailer and good luck getting it home! :beer:
